Ripple Confirms Plan to Apply for MiCA License to Expand EU Market

By: theblockbeats.news|2025/07/15 14:42:11

BlockBeats News, July 15th, according to Cointelegraph, payment solution company Ripple has confirmed plans to apply for the Markets in Crypto-Assets Regulation (MiCA) license to expand into the European Union market.

A Ripple spokesperson stated that the company intends to "achieve MiCA compliance" as it recognizes the "significant opportunity in the European market."

At the time of this announcement, Ripple had completed the registration of Ripple Payments Europe S.A. in Luxembourg at the end of April this year.
